Swiss Environmental Consulting Firm Chooses SuperGIS Desktop

May 17, 2016 By GISuser

Supergeo Technologies Inc., the GIS software and solution provider, announces that one of its core product, SuperGIS Desktop, was earlier selected by the Swiss consulting firm, Avis Vert, to process and analyze spatial data. 

Avis Vert is an environmental engineering and consulting office, headquartered in Geneva, Switzerland. For years, this company has dedicated to executing various environmental projects, such as environmental impact analysis, urban ecology training courses, and river course improving plans.

GIS can help experts from different domains to gain spatial insights and achieve goals more efficiently. Taking ecological research as an example, professionals may find undiscovered relations between animal activities and landscapes by mapping wildlife habitats together with a topographic map. Environmental consulting firms can also conduct buffering and other geoprocessing quickly to identify the restricted areas of a construction project by GIS. By equipping an excluded extension, the Biodiversity Analyst, SuperGIS Desktop can offer extra advantages to companies like Avis Vert. This unique tool can help experts to assess the biodiversity of a region by calculating indices like species richness, diversity, and evenness. And the results could be illustrated and exported as density analysis charts, helping an overall environmental evaluation and impact estimation.
